Streamlining Business Travel to Cuba City, Wisconsin: Finding the Best Corporate Travel Agencies
When your business travel plans include destinations like Cuba City, Wisconsin, partnering with the right corporate travel agency becomes more than just a convenience—it's a strategic advantage. While Cuba City itself is a charming, close-knit community in Grant County, business travelers often find themselves navigating a regional itinerary that might include nearby commercial hubs like Dubuque, Iowa, or Platteville, Wisconsin, alongside visits to local manufacturing facilities, agricultural cooperatives, or supplier meetings in the Driftless Area. The best corporate travel agencies for this region understand this unique blend of rural charm and practical business needs.
A top-tier agency specializing in this corridor won't just book a flight to the nearest major airport, which is often Dubuque Regional Airport (DBQ) or Dane County Regional Airport (MSN) in Madison. They will provide comprehensive ground logistics. This includes arranging rental cars suited for rural roads, understanding the drive times between scattered business locations, and even booking accommodations that balance proximity to your meetings with the amenities needed to recharge. Given that some corporate visits might be to facilities outside the town proper, an agency with regional knowledge can be invaluable in optimizing your schedule to minimize windshield time.
Look for agencies that offer robust duty of care programs. Traveling for business in Southwest Wisconsin, especially during winter months, requires proactive planning. The best agencies monitor local weather conditions affecting Highway 80 or 81, provide real-time alerts for road closures, and have contingency plans ready. They ensure you have reliable contact information and can assist swiftly if a meeting in Cuba City runs long and you need to change a subsequent flight out of Madison or Dubuque.
Furthermore, a valuable agency will have insight into the local ecosystem. They can recommend reliable car services for multi-stop days, suggest restaurants in Cuba City or nearby Hazel Green for client dinners, and know which hotels in the area offer the best business centers or meeting rooms for last-minute prep. Their knowledge extends beyond simple bookings to creating a seamless, productive trip.
When evaluating corporate travel agencies, ask specific questions about their experience with the Tri-State Area (Wisconsin, Iowa, Illinois). Do they understand the typical travel patterns for industries prevalent in the Cuba City region, such as agriculture, logistics, or small-scale manufacturing? Can they manage a trip that combines a flight into a hub with a complex series of regional car rentals? The right partner will not only manage costs and policy compliance but will genuinely reduce the friction of business travel to this distinctive part of Wisconsin, letting you focus entirely on the purpose of your visit.
